Photographer Hans Kemp is behind a fascinating series called Bikes of Burden, photos that show motorbikes carrying incredible loads of stuff. With almost 90 million vendors and consumers buying and selling something on virtually every street corner, Vietnam is the perfect place to capture amazing scene after scene of cargo being carried on the back of motorbikes.
